Alt-Tab only cycles through open APPLICATIONS (programs)
Alt-ESC will not only cycle through open applications, but will also
cycle through open CHILD windows.
Unfortunately (usually) neither will help you find the window if it is
off screen.

Options > Customize > 8.0 View
Section 8.11 Monitor Potential Problems
Click change settings and remove check marks from any of the problems
you do NOT want monitored.
